Naya Tapper

Who is Ilona Maher? Here’s what to know about the US women’s rugby sevens Olympian and TikTok star

2024-07-31 03:30:02 SAINT-DENIS, France (AP) — Rugby sevens star Ilona Maher has been a huge hit on social media as…

2 months ago

Americans shock Australia with last-second try to win bronze in women’s rugby

2024-07-31 00:50:02 The American women looked to play spoilers against Australia and its fast-paced offense in the bronze medal match.…

2 months ago